I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

VB.NET Discussion :

Affichage CheckBox ds DataGridView


Sujet :

VB.NET

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Membre éclairé
    Profil pro
    Inscrit en
    Juin 2002
    Messages
    314
    Détails du profil
    Informations personnelles :
    Localisation : Suisse

    Informations forums :
    Inscription : Juin 2002
    Messages : 314
    Par défaut Affichage CheckBox ds DataGridView
    Bonjour,
    Je remplis un DataGridView de cette façon :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    For i = 0 To Groupes_DataTable.Rows.Count() - 1
                .Rows.Add(Groupes_DataTable.Rows(i).Item("C_NomChampionnat").ToString.Trim, _
                Format(Convert.ToDateTime(Groupes_DataTable.Rows(i).Item("C_Date")), "dd MMM yyyy"), _
                Groupes_DataTable.Rows(i).Item("C_Discipline"), _
                Groupes_DataTable.Rows(i).Item("C_Stand"), _
                Groupes_DataTable.Rows(i).Item("C_Termine"), _
                Groupes_DataTable.Rows(i).Item("C_Debute"), _
                Groupes_DataTable.Rows(i).Item("C_IdChampionnat"))
             Next
    Les champs C_Termine et C_Debute de ma table sont des champs Access boolean (oui/non ).
    Le DataGridView m'affiche "False" ou "True" J'aimerai à la place de "False" ou "True" afficher des case à cocher, CheckBox

    Merci d'avance
    FikoU

  2. #2
    Membre expérimenté
    Homme Profil pro
    Freelance
    Inscrit en
    Février 2008
    Messages
    312
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 36
    Localisation : France, Loire Atlantique (Pays de la Loire)

    Informations professionnelles :
    Activité : Freelance

    Informations forums :
    Inscription : Février 2008
    Messages : 312
    Par défaut
    moi quand je créais des champs booléen avec ma base de données ( c'était sql server ) quand je les insérai dans un datagridView il me mettait automatiquement des cases a cocher
    normalement si tu fait une requete select C_Debute... que tu insere dans le dataset lier a ton datagridView il devrait automatiquement te mettre des cases a cocher

  3. #3
    Membre éclairé
    Profil pro
    Inscrit en
    Juin 2002
    Messages
    314
    Détails du profil
    Informations personnelles :
    Localisation : Suisse

    Informations forums :
    Inscription : Juin 2002
    Messages : 314
    Par défaut
    Salut,
    Effectivement si je fais ça :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
     
    Me.MonGrid.DataSource = DtSet
    Me.MonGrid.DataMember = "My_Table"
    J'ai les cases à cocher
    Mais je ne veut pas afficher tout les champs de ma table d'ou la boucle For.

    @+FiloU

  4. #4
    Membre expérimenté
    Homme Profil pro
    Freelance
    Inscrit en
    Février 2008
    Messages
    312
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 36
    Localisation : France, Loire Atlantique (Pays de la Loire)

    Informations professionnelles :
    Activité : Freelance

    Informations forums :
    Inscription : Février 2008
    Messages : 312
    Par défaut
    Mais je ne veut pas afficher tout les champs de ma table d'ou la boucle For.
    tu veux donc afficher que certains champs de ta table répondant à un critère précis
    tu doit faire un code dans ce genre la ( adapté a sql server mais ca doit pas etre si différent pour access)
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
     
    string="select champ where critère=critère que tu veux"
    dim da as dataadapter
    dim commande as new sqlcommand(string)
    da.selectcommand=commande
    da.fill(dataset, "matable")
    datagridview.datasource=dataset.tables("matable")

Discussions similaires

  1. Réponses: 0
    Dernier message: 22/10/2009, 10h55
  2. [Tableaux] Affichage checkbox
    Par djinko dans le forum Langage
    Réponses: 5
    Dernier message: 29/03/2007, 17h03
  3. [C# 2.0] Mettre à jour l'affichage d'une dataGridView
    Par nicolas.pied dans le forum Accès aux données
    Réponses: 4
    Dernier message: 31/01/2007, 14h36
  4. Probleme d'affichage avec un DataGridView
    Par kekesilo dans le forum Windows Forms
    Réponses: 3
    Dernier message: 30/01/2007, 14h12
  5. Réponses: 2
    Dernier message: 30/10/2006, 22h14

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o